The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C) value generated for the retrieved availability group configuration data from the Windows Server Failover Clustering (WSFC) store does not match that stored with the data for the availability group with ID '%1!s!'. The availability group data in the WSFC store may have been modified outside SQL Server, or the data is corrupt. If the error persists, you may need to drop and recreate the availability group.
